I am new to Qlik sense, I have a filter in my dashboard named "FiscalYear" having values like FY23, FY24, etc. I want to select the latest FiscalYear value by default every time the dashboard loads. The user can also select multiple values from the filter and deselect the default selected value.
I was trying to implement this by using the bookmark method but I am unable to find the exact field expression to be applied in the filter so that it will always select the latest FiscalYear.
I have tried Max, Maxstring but non of them worked. Can someone please help me with this?
If there are any alternative or more efficient ways to do this then please suggest.

No, you're right. When experimenting I can't get it to work with a text field. Perhaps you could make it a numeric field instead, using dual(). I have done this with numeric fields, so I know it should work then.
Actually it's a requirement that I need to get the latest FY value from this string data type only, not allowed to change it to numeric data type.
Can you add a flag in your data model so that you have a new field next to FiscalYear, named e.g. latestFiscalYear and set it to 1 for the latest FiscalYear? If so you could do this search in the FiscalYear field:
=[latestFiscalYear]=1
